Transaction 71526150484c9a63b2cb104ad25997121f7e67784a503e031fa99d5a65f9c0ab
1 Input
1 Output
-
71526150484c9a63b2cb104ad25997121f7e67784a503e031fa99d5a65f9c0ab:0
- value
- 89000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fec9c4a6927e0d0f30a34c1aeae0c6fa876c5415 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QECLpjJUn5XbE3BFs41ZevMPTu2x7CKNr